Emma Watson and Benedict Cumberbatch have been appointed as visiting fellows at Lady Margaret Hall by Oxford University.

Watson (25) and Cumberbatch (39) will have a duties which are supposed to enrich the cultural life of the university, reported People magazine.

“At a minimum, we’d like them to drop in occasionally at college, eat with us and meet informally with a variety of the LMH community,” Alan Rusbridger, the college’s principal, said.

“We’d like them to do one thing a bit more structured. It could be a conversation or debate, a performance, a lecture or seminar, a form of outreach — or something we haven’t thought of. We can imagine fascinating interactions or collaborations between them,” she added.

The actors are among nine other fellows, all chosen from what Rusbridger said was a “variety of background, callings and professions.”

The fellows are also intended to help the academic community cross over into the various professional worlds the fellows are a part of.
